UPES Partnership Agreement

Medical education pathway establishes unique opportunity for aspiring medical doctors in India.

Medical University of the Americas (MUA) and UPES, a university in Dehradun, India, are pleased to highlight their new partnership, which benefits students who plan to pursue an international medical school education. This pathway will provide UPES graduates who have successfully achieved the Pre-Medical Science Certificate* with direct entry** into MUA’s 4-year MD program. Excitingly, eligible participants will also receive extensive financial support via partnership scholarships!

MUA knows the world needs more practicing physicians, which is why we strive to make our comprehensive medical education and hands-on training more financially accessible for all. As part of this commitment, successful UPES Pre-Medical Science Certificate program graduates are now eligible for the scholarships listed below. When combined with our cost-effective tuition and fee rates, aspiring medical doctors from India can now achieve their education goals much more readily. 

  • General scholarship: Eligible pathway participants will receive a $40,000 USD scholarship, distributed evenly over the 10 semesters of the MUA MD program.
  • Inaugural cohort incentive: Eligible UPES graduates who enroll in the inaugural intake, in September 2025, will receive an additional $10,000 USD scholarship, also distributed evenly over the 10 semesters of the MD program.

“The collaboration with MUA is an exciting step in our mission to nurture skilled and globally competent medical professionals,” shared Dr. Padma Venkat, Dean, School of Health Sciences and Technology (SOHST), UPES. “This program will empower students with an exceptional learning experience that combines strong academic foundations with practical clinical exposure across multiple regions.”

“Together with UPES, we have carefully designed a pre-medical program that offers students a clear, structured pathway to medical school,” said Dr. Dona Rimanishta, Partnerships Coordinator for MUA. “Through this collaboration, students can complete a one-year Pre-Medical Science Certificate at UPES, which will serve as foundational preparation for MUA’s 4-Year MD program. We are proud to have this partnership in place and look forward to welcoming UPES students to MUA, where they will take the next step toward becoming future medical doctors.”

*Successful completion means achieving a minimum cumulative GPA of 3.0 on a 4.0 scale in the Pre-Medical Science Certificate program and successfully completing all courses in the program with no failed subjects.

**To receive direct entry, UPES Pre-Medical Science Certificate program graduates must submit an application, submit a valid 10+2 certificate or equivalent high school diploma, submit high school and UPES transcripts, satisfactorily complete an interview with the MUA admissions team, provide two letters of recommendation and submit a personal statement.
